Summary of the contracting process

Wirral Council is exploring services to provide short-term emergency accommodation for children and young people presenting in crisis, particularly those who might otherwise remain in hospital or be placed in another unsuitable setting. The requirement concerns welfare services for children and young people, including accommodation and associated support appropriate to emergency placements. Delivery is in Wirral, within the wider Merseyside area. The council is seeking views from providers on viable ways to meet this need, rather than purchasing a defined package of accommodation at this stage. Relevant organisations may include specialist emergency placement providers, children’s residential care providers, supported accommodation operators and other organisations able to respond safely and quickly to urgent placements for vulnerable young people.

The procurement is at the planning stage and is currently a soft market testing and engagement exercise, not an invitation to tender. Wirral Council expects to use the responses to understand viable delivery options before developing a future procurement. Interested providers are expected to complete and upload the soft market testing exercise through The Chest by 23 September 2026, with the council’s stated time being 12 noon. The planned contract period is from 1 June 2027 to 31 May 2032. The service is being considered under the light-touch regime. One service lot is identified, covering the planned emergency placement requirement. No tender submission, contract value or award decision is established at this stage.
